Polar ice could be towed to an area with high freshwater demand. This has been studied at least since the 1970s. The transport cost could be lower than desalinization of seawater. That by itself is not a very strong statement, since desalinization is quite expensive. Anyway, the idea pops up from time to time. I think that in any year the supply of polar ice is high, so this is not really a climate-change story. It is all about transport costs, and what you can sell the water for at the destination port.
Back when it was studied nobody was thinking about the environmental impact of hauling a huge ice cube into a temperate climate port. How much damage would a huge chunk of ice cause to a local port? That easily could be enough temperature change and freshwater insertion to question the effect on the destination.

Water Desalination Capacity Climbs on Power, Energy Needs - Bloomberg Its really about how much it costs for the water. That tow boat needs diesel, while desalination energy can come from solar, wind, nuclear, natural gas, etc. This often makes the desalization less expensive than if you could tow. Back in the 1970s oil was less expensive, and solar much more expensive. In 20 years I expect a great deal of solar desalinazation aided perhaps by electriicity, natural gas, and/or biomass. Back to the top, the cited study found that 2010 - 2012 La Nina melt was slow. The authors also said that they expect the next El Nino to be fast. More fundamentally that recent decadal melt trends are increasing. So, the canny PC readers might think about that. A lot of science-based websites have weighed in on this, but if anyone prefers comforting messages from affinity websites, I can't stop ye. Everybody likes comfort. Just to say, that once a big chunk of grounded ice melts, its sea level rise will persist. The Pine Island Glacier represents about 1 centimeter SLR. There are others of similar magnitude nearby.
